					Originally Posted by Pilot172000  Before I jumped into this hobby several years ago I did diligent research and read tons of threads on this board about SGC vs. PSA.  I decided to go with SGC as they seemed to be the PRe-War favorite at the time.  The first graded card I ever had was a Willie Mays and the PSA holder seemed flimsy.  I bought strictly SGC cards until one day slipping up and purchasing a Nap Lajoie Portrait in a PSA case.  It was love at first site.  I have bought mostly PSA since and am seriouly considering moving my SGC cards to PSA holders for conformity.  I still think that SGC is a better grader and their cases are rock solid, but are bulky, heavy and take up a lot more space than the PSA cards.  Space is finite at my house with three boys and another child on the way.  I choose PSA for more practical purposes and find both companies to be very good at what they do.  I have had good experiences with both and wouldnt balk at buying a SGC card if it was the right card. |
